Hormonal Medications and Their Role in Treating Cancers

Cancer is a complex group of diseases characterized by the uncontrolled growth of abnormal cells. Among the various treatment modalities available, hormonal medications play a crucial role, particularly in hormone-sensitive cancers such as breast and prostate cancer. Understanding how these medications work and their significance in cancer therapy is essential for patients and healthcare providers alike.

Hormonal therapies, also known as hormone treatments or endocrine therapies, target the hormones that fuel the growth of certain types of cancer cells. For example, breast cancer can be influenced by estrogen in some patients, while prostate cancer is often driven by androgens like testosterone.

One of the most widely recognized hormonal medications is tamoxifen, used predominantly in the treatment of estrogen receptor-positive breast cancer. Tamoxifen works by blocking the effects of estrogen on the breast tissue, essentially starving the cancer cells of the hormone they need to grow. Studies have shown that tamoxifen can significantly reduce the risk of cancer recurrence and improve overall survival rates in affected patients.

Another important class of hormonal medications is aromatase inhibitors, such as anastrozole and letrozole. These medications lower estrogen levels in postmenopausal women by inhibiting the aromatase enzyme, which converts androgens into estrogens. This approach is effective in managing hormone-responsive breast cancer and is typically considered for patients who have completed initial treatments.

In prostate cancer, androgen deprivation therapy (ADT) is a cornerstone of treatment. This may involve the use of luteinizing hormone-releasing hormone (LHRH) agonists like leuprolide, which reduce testosterone levels in the body, or anti-androgens such as bicalutamide, which block the effects of testosterone on cancer cells. Lowering testosterone can lead to decreased cancer growth and improved patient outcomes.

Hormonal medications are not without side effects, and patients may experience symptoms ranging from hot flashes and weight gain to mood changes and increased risk of certain conditions. However, careful management by healthcare professionals can help mitigate these effects, making the overall benefits of hormonal treatments outweigh the risks.

In addition to their direct effects on cancer growth, hormonal medications can be integral to a broader treatment strategy. For instance, they may be used in conjunction with surgery, radiation, or chemotherapy to enhance overall effectiveness. Oncologists often tailor hormonal treatments based on tumor characteristics, patient health, and treatment goals.
